Problems solved by technology

[0002] Nowadays, the power-on of electrical equipment is basically to directly insert the plug connected to it into the power supply hole of the socket to cooperate, and the socket and the power supply connection will always be in the power-on state, although this plug-in method is simple to operate and relatively easy to use. It is convenient, but after the plug is inserted into the power supply hole, there are no other locking parts to lock the plug. Sudden power failure of electrical equipment will directly cause damage to electrical equipment in severe cases. Therefore, the existing plugging method has the risk of unstable power supply connection. In addition, when the electrical equipment is not in use, the plug is often inserted through the power supply hole Pull out the power supply hole, which will cause the power supply hole to be exposed. If a child inserts the metal rod into the power supply hole, it will not only damage the power supply hole but also cause an electric shock accident for the child, which poses a great safety hazard

Abstract

The invention discloses a novel safely locked power supply plugging device comprising a socket body which is arranged on the wall and a plug body which is cooperatively connected with the socket bodyin a plugging way. The middle of the rear end surface of the plug body is provided with a plug. The rear end surface of the plug body is provided with two inserting columns which are symmetrically arranged on the left and right sides of the plug. Each of the two inserting columns is provided with a locking slot, and the two locking slots are oppositely arranged. The middle position of the front end surface of the socket body is provided with a power supply hole used for insertion of the plug for cooperative connection. The socket body is internally provided with an accommodating cavity. The overall structure is simple and the power supply stability is great so that the accident of electric shock in the present life can be reduced, and the life and property safety of people can be effectively guaranteed; besides, operation of the whole device can be realized by the single motor so that the structural setting is quite reasonable, operation is easy and convenient and the device is suitable for popularization and application.
